The Intel Rejection of eBay
The Intel court rejects the eBay approach. The court holds that, at a minimum, impairment of value requires the placing of a significant burden on a computer’s computing capacity. The court holds that Hamidi’s emails did not place a significant burden on Intel’s computers and hence the court holds that the emails did not impair the value of the computers. The court also holds that there the emails did not cause any economic or financial loss to Intel that would constitute a harm to a legally protected interest. Hence, the court found that there was no trespass.
